Join us as a Data Engineer

  • This is an exciting opportunity to use your technical expertise to collaborate with colleagues and build effortless, digital first customer experiences
  • You’ll be simplifying the bank by developing innovative data driven solutions, using insight to be commercially successful, and keeping our customers’ and the bank’s data safe and secure
  • Participating actively in the data engineering community, you’ll deliver opportunities to support the bank’s strategic direction while building your network across the bank
  • We're offering this role at associate level
What you'll do

As a Data Engineer, you’ll play a key role in driving value for our customers by building data solutions. You’ll be carrying out data engineering tasks to build, maintain, test and optimise a scalable data architecture, as well as carrying out data extractions, transforming data to make it usable to data analysts and scientists, and loading data into data platforms.

You’ll also be:

  • Developing comprehensive knowledge of the bank’s data structures and metrics, advocating change where needed for product development
  • Practicing DevOps adoption in the delivery of data engineering, proactively performing root cause analysis and resolving issues
  • Collaborating closely with core technology and architecture teams in the bank to build data knowledge and data solutions
  • Developing a clear understanding of data platform cost levers to build cost effective and strategic solutions
  • Sourcing new data using the most appropriate tooling and integrating it into the overall solution to deliver for our customers
The skills you'll need

To be successful in this role, you’ll need a good understanding of data usage and dependencies with wider teams and the end customer, as well as experience of extracting value and features from large scale data.

You’ll also demonstrate:

  • At least five years of experience of ETL technical design, including data quality testing, cleansing and monitoring, and data warehousing and data modelling capabilities
  • Experience in engineering and maintaining innovative, customer-centric, high-performance, secure, and robust solutions using AI
  • Experience of using programming languages alongside knowledge of data and software engineering fundamentals
  • Good knowledge of modern code development practices
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to proactively engage with a wide range of stakeholders

What you need to know about the Chennai Tech Scene

To locals, it's no secret that South India is leading the charge in big data infrastructure. While the environmental impact of data centers has long been a concern, emerging hubs like Chennai are favored by companies seeking ready access to renewable energy resources, which provide more sustainable and cost-effective solutions. As a result, Chennai, along with neighboring Bengaluru and Hyderabad, is poised for significant growth, with a projected 65 percent increase in data center capacity over the next decade.
